In tetradynamous condition there are six stamens, 4 are long and 2 are short i.e. 4 + 2 arrangement of stamens. It is characterstic feature of cruciferae members. In liliaceae 6 stamens are arranged in whorls of 3 each (3 + 3). In solanaceae there are 5 stamens they are epipetallous and polyandrous. In malvaceae there are numerous stamens that are monoadelphous.
